test(aggregators): add comprehensive test suite for Kagi News aggregator

Adds 57 tests with 83% code coverage across all components:

Test coverage by component:
- RSS Fetcher (5 tests): fetch, retry, timeout, invalid XML
- HTML Parser (8 tests): all sections, missing sections, full story
- Rich Text Formatter (10 tests): facets, UTF-8, multi-byte chars
- State Manager (12 tests): deduplication, rolling window, persistence
- Config Manager (3 tests): YAML validation, env vars
- Main Orchestrator (9 tests): E2E flow, error isolation, dry-run
- E2E Tests (6 skipped): require live Coves API

Test results: 57 passed, 6 skipped, 1 warning in 8.76s

Fixtures:
- Real Kagi News RSS item with all sections (sample_rss_item.xml)
- Used to validate parser against actual feed structure

All tests use pytest with mocking for HTTP requests (responses library).
